Our Paediatric Occupational Therapy Services
Every child has individual therapy sessions with an occupational therapist. The program for these sessions is individually tailored for your child. In collaboration with you, we set and work towards goals which will make a real difference in your child’s life. If appropriate, your child is able to join one or more of our group intervention programs at some point. This may be to practise skills they have learned in one-on-one sessions, or to develop social skills more generally. Goals and programs are all specific to each child’s needs.
High demand for services means that your child will probably be placed on a waitlist rather than starting with us immediately. We want to help every child we can, but our resources are limited. Our goal is to keep the waitlist as short as possible for as many people as possible. We understand that you contacted us seeking help now, which is why we offer a Start-Up Session. This aims to bridge the gap, giving you clear, practical support while you wait for an ongoing therapy spot.

The Story of Little Hands OT
Katharina Senger, a highly qualified paediatric occupational therapist, started Little Hands OT in August 2015. The service was initially part-time and mobile, with Katharina traveling to clients’ homes. As more children and their families wanted to work with her, the work rapidly became full-time. Time spent traveling limited the number of children Katharina could help, so she switched to clinic-based sessions, first in-house in Melba and then in Holt.
The workload continued to increase. The team grew to include admin staff, therapy assistants and then additional occupational therapists. In 2020, Little Hands moved to Luke Street near the Kippax shops. The practice has continued to grow, and the clinic facilities have expanded in 2024.
